Monsieur Grandet is a very rich man whose chief care is his gold. He runs his household with exacting miserly attention and his wife and daughter suffer a Spartan existence. On the evening of his daughter Eug nie's twenty third birthday his foppish nephew Charles suddenly arrives from Paris. Eug nie has never known passion. Now in an instant she falls in love and her life is changed forever.
